Why New Hotels Matter for Business Travel

Booking new hotels isn’t a luxury—it’s a strategic advantage. Newly built or recently opened hotels feature:

  • Soundproofed, quiet rooms to eliminate sleep disruption before key meetings.
  • Modern workspaces with fast, reliable WiFi and ergonomic furniture.
  • Up-to-date cleanliness protocols that meet today’s heightened expectations.
  • On-site business amenities like conference rooms, co-working lounges, or 24/7 business centers.

New properties are also more likely to be located in up-and-coming commercial districts or offer shorter commute times to conference centers and airports—saving valuable hours on tight itineraries.

ROI: Better Hotels = Better Business Outcomes

Poor hotel conditions often translate to poor performance—whether it’s missed briefings due to sleepless nights, tech problems during remote calls, or general morale drops.

New hotel stays provide tangible business ROI:

  • Increased focus and productivity through quieter environments and reliable technology.
  • Higher employee satisfaction thanks to well-designed, clean accommodations.
  • Fewer support issues: fewer calls about WiFi, noise, or room switches means less time troubleshooting for support staff.
  • Improved brand image when staff meet clients from top-tier accommodations.
